* We have previously reported the results of the primary and secondary outcomes of a randomized study aiming to investigate the impact of a restrictive transfusion protocol on the magnitude of reduction in blood transfusion in a typically mixed general surgery population subjected to major abdominal surgery. * The main finding of that study was a reduction in red blood cell usage with the implementation of a restrictive transfusion regimen. This was achieved without adversely affecting clinical outcome in the population studied. * The aim of this secondary analysis performed on a subgroup of 20 patients from the original study was to determine whether there are any differences in the postoperative immunologic response, as expressed by the production of inflammatory mediators, between a restrictive approach to red cell transfusion and a more liberal strategy.

Patients allocated to the restrictive transfusion strategy were transfused only when their hemoglobin concentration decreased below 7.7 g d dL-1 and were then maintained at hemoglobin concentrations between 7.7 and 9.9 g d dL-1.
Patients assigned to the liberal strategy were transfused when their hemoglobin concentration fell below 9.9 g dL-1, aiming at maintaining hemoglobin at or above 10 g dL-1.
